What is a Ratio?<\/strong><\/p>\n\n\n\n<ul class=\"has-large-font-size wp-block-list\">\n<li>A ratio is a way to compare two quantities.<\/li>\n\n\n\n<li>It tells you how much of one thing there is compared to another.<\/li>\n\n\n\n<li>The ratio of two numbers can be written in three forms:\n<ul class=\"wp-block-list\">\n<li><strong>A to B<\/strong> (e.g., 3:4)<\/li>\n\n\n\n<li><strong>A\/B<\/strong> (e.g., 3\/4)<\/li>\n\n\n\n<li><strong>A is to B<\/strong> (e.g., 3 is to 4)<\/li>\n<\/ul>\n<\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ity is-style-wide\"\/>\n\n\n\n<p class=\"has-text-color has-link-color has-large-font-size wp-elements-45545334e1efc76ec038d5607ff6cd63\" style=\"color:#000060\"><strong>2. Simplifying Ratios:<\/strong><\/p>\n\n\n\n<ul class=\"has-large-font-size wp-block-list\">\n<li>Like fractions, ratios can be simplified by dividing both parts of the ratio by their greatest common divisor (GCD).<\/li>\n\n\n\n<li>Example: The ratio 6:8 can be simplified to 3:4 by dividing both 6 and 8 by 2.<\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ity is-style-wide\"\/>\n\n\n\n<p class=\"has-text-color has-link-color has-large-font-size wp-elements-f9c9a8bab383c325f79c061ba70a851f\" style=\"color:#000060\"><strong>3. Equivalent Ratios:<\/strong><\/p>\n\n\n\n<ul class=\"has-large-font-size wp-block-list\">\n<li>Two ratios are equivalent if they simplify to the same ratio.<\/li>\n\n\n\n<li>Example: 4:6 is equivalent to 2:3 because both can be simplified by dividing by 2.<\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ity is-style-wide\"\/>\n\n\n\n<p class=\"has-text-color has-link-color has-large-font-size wp-elements-cdc0e78f4ac816876853d4863eaeb831\" style=\"color:#000060\"><strong>4. Ratio as a Fraction:<\/strong><\/p>\n\n\n\n<ul class=\"has-large-font-size wp-block-list\">\n<li>A ratio can be expressed as a fraction.<\/li>\n\n\n\n<li>Example: 3:5 can be written as 3\/5.<\/li>\n\n\n\n<li>This helps in finding proportions and solving problems involving ratios.<\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ity is-style-wide\"\/>\n\n\n\n<p class=\"has-text-color has-link-color has-large-font-size wp-elements-073996477d98c84d3de43045c78135fd\" style=\"color:#000060\"><strong>5. Part-to-Part and Part-to-Whole Ratios:<\/strong><\/p>\n\n\n\n<ul class=\"has-large-font-size wp-block-list\">\n<li><strong>Part-to-Part<\/strong>: Compares one part of a whole to another part. Example: The ratio of boys to girls in a class is 3:2.<\/li>\n\n\n\n<li><strong>Part-to-Whole<\/strong>: Compares one part of a whole to the entire whole. Example: The ratio of boys to the total class is 3:5.<\/li>\n<\/ul>\n\n\n\n<p class=\"has-text-align-center has-text-color has-large-font-size\" style=\"color:#105000\"><strong>Learn with an example<\/strong><\/p>\n\n\n\n<div class=\"wp-block-group has-primary-color has-text-color has-background has-link-color has-large-font-size wp-elements-7a86ecae35fb4706ceab4ccc985a74c2\" style=\"background-color:#f7caf0\"><div class=\"wp-block-group__inner-container is-layout-flow wp-block-group-is-layout-flow\">\n<div class=\"wp-block-group has-primary-color has-background-background-color has-text-color has-background has-link-color wp-elements-a1ab73092fd987ba09193f76f4d54be0\"><div class=\"wp-block-group__inner-container is-layout-flow wp-block-group-is-layout-flow\">\n<div class=\"wp-block-group has-background-background-color has-background\"><div class=\"wp-block-group__inner-container is-layout-flow wp-block-group-is-layout-flow\">\n<p class=\"has-text-color has-link-color wp-elements-33af41f903bedc7bc2ece69c15642e28\" style=\"color:#b00012\"><strong>\u2708\ufe0f What is the ratio of rectangles to total shapes?<\/strong><\/p>\n\n\n<div class=\"wp-block-image is-resized\">\n<figure class=\"aligncenter size-full\"><img loading=\"lazy\" decoding=\"async\" width=\"600\" height=\"300\" src=\"https:\/\/8thclass.deltapublications.in\/wp-content\/uploads\/2022\/12\/Untitled-design-34.png\" alt=\"\" class=\"wp-image-3532\" srcset=\"https:\/\/8thclass.deltapublications.in\/wp-content\/uploads\/2022\/12\/Untitled-design-34.png 600w, https:\/\/8thclass.deltapublications.in\/wp-content\/uploads\/2022\/12\/Untitled-design-34-300x150.png 300w\" sizes=\"auto, (max-width: 600px) 100vw, 600px\" \/><\/figure><\/div><\/div><\/div>\n\n\n\n<p>\u2708\ufe0f Write your answer as a fraction.
